Output 777063fa279a9269600441faaf2318b60f5c34f158b72ce26c68346c117aa1ba:20

value
71928284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22fb1504bdb818881055f83303d09a7aff2c5312 OP_EQUAL
address
MB67zSdu972eL7ePQqV6bjBdJ68n5vqWzd
transaction
777063fa279a9269600441faaf2318b60f5c34f158b72ce26c68346c117aa1ba
spent
true